NookLocal.com Launches to Put the "Local" Back Into Real Estate Across Greater Philadelphia and the Lehigh Valley
* A team of Pennsylvania natives has launched NookLocal.com, a homegrown real estate search built specifically for the suburbs of Greater Philadelphia and the Lehigh Valley. By pairing map-based home search with deep local data - school districts, academic outcomes, support and services, overdose rates, school climate and safety, property taxes, and town-by-town detail - NookLocal gives buyers and renters the neighborhood context the national portals leave out.
NEW HOPE, Pa. -- A group of Philadelphia natives today launched NookLocal.com, a real estate search platform built from the ground up for the towns they grew up in: the suburbs of Greater Philadelphia and the Lehigh Valley. The site brings together homes for sale and for rent with the kind of local detail - school districts, property taxes, and town-by-town context - that people here actually use to make a move.

NookLocal covers five Pennsylvania counties - Bucks, Montgomery, Lehigh, Northampton, and Berks - stitching together Greater Philadelphia's suburbs and the full Lehigh Valley, from Allentown and Bethlehem to Easton. Listings are sourced from the regional MLS and refreshed throughout the day, so what buyers see is current.
What sets the platform apart is the local data layered onto every search:
- School district search for homes for sale and for rent organized by school district.
- Town and neighborhood hubs covering dozens of boroughs and townships, each with its own page.
- School district pages with the information families weigh most.
- Property-tax detail at the town and county level, so the real monthly cost is clear up front.
- Free saved searches and instant new-listing alerts, no cost to browse.
- Crime and bullying stats, for the parents.
